Customer's Fault Description
The remote control will not communicate with the control box. I have tried resetting with no luck. The control box flashes looking for a signal but cannot find one. I left the batteries in the control over winter so that might be the problem. I have tried new batteries but still doesn't work.
Remote Fixer Repair Response
This Truma Motor mover remote control arrived safely from Eccles-on-Sea and on testing was found to be transmitting a strong 433Mhz signal as per normal operation (see image). The remote was then tested randomly over a 2 day period with no fault being replicated.
This item has been classed as no fault found.
